Indirect rotary calciners | IDRECO S.r.l.

Indirect calciner purpose is not limited to water evaporation, but depending on the desired process, chemical reaction (ie thermal dissociation, oxidation or reduction) can occur inside the calciner so that final product can differ from inlet product. The heat transfer is mainly by radiation, while a small rate is given by conduction.

Indirect Rotary Calciners, Heat Transfer Equipment ...

Indirect Rotary Calciners. Radiation is the primary mode of heat transfer. An indirect rotary calciner can be supplied either gas, oil or electrically heated, and usually feature multiple furnace zones. Rotary Calciner Rotary calciner is a high-temperature processing equipment modified on the basis of traditional rotary cylinder dryer by changing the form of its heat source. The material enters the furnace through the kiln head feeder, and an arc-shaped heating device (stacked kiln body) is added outside the middle portion of the cylinder. Performance and Cost Data for Indirect Heat Rotary Steam ...

Performance and Cost Data for Indirect-Heat Rotary Steam-Tube Dryers Table 12-22 contains data for a number of standard sizes of steam-tube dryers.Prices tabulated are for ordinary carbon steel construction. Installed costs will run from 150 to 300 percent of purchase cost. The thermal efficiency of steam-tube units will range from 70 to 90 percent, if a well-insulated cylinder is assumed.
